The is essential software that enables your Windows 11 system to communicate with Wi-Fi adapters using the RTL8811CU chipset. This driver supports dual-band connectivity (2.4GHz and 5GHz) and high-speed 802.11ac standards, making it a popular solution for adding Wi-Fi to desktops or upgrading older laptops. In the era of ubiquitous connectivity, a humble USB Wi‑Fi adapter can mean the difference between seamless productivity and the quiet frustration of dropped packets. The Realtek 8811CU chipset—commonly branded across budget USB network adapters—promises modern 802.11ac speeds in a tiny, plug‑and‑play package. Yet on Windows 11, that promise often collides with the brittle realities of driver support, compatibility quirks, and the subtle bureaucracy of modern OS updates.
